COLORADO: Mona Shah and Joe Samagond of Fremont lately accomplished a memorable drive throughout Colorado. “We experienced a symphony of color, altitude and awe,” Joe mentioned. “From the crisp, pine-scented air, the journey felt like an untamed invitation to embrace nature’s grandeur.” They made stops in Denver, Boulder, Rocky Mountain Nationwide Park, Glenwood Scorching Springs, Aspen and Breckenridge. They particularly cherished the golden Aspens, the decision of the elk and the profound stillness of the Continental Divide.

TRAVEL TIPS: Joe recommends reserving a timed entry move to enter the Rocky Mountains Nationwide Park on recreation.gov. Entries are simply $2, turn out to be accessible a month or two upfront and promote rapidly.

EGYPT: Wendy Walleigh and husband Rick Walleigh of Los Altos lately returned from Egypt and Jordan, the place they considered many websites that had been between 2,000 and 5,000 years outdated. Stated Wendy: “One of the most spectacular is Abu Simbel in Upper Egypt along Lake Nasser, near the Sudan border. It comprises the Temple for Ramses II and a Temple for his wife, Nefertiti. They were literally hewn from rocks surrounding them, with tombs and bas relief walls of figures below this entrance. The size of these outer statues is so impressive.”
